public function getList()
 {
     $vehicules = Vehicule::all();
     $membres = User::all();
     $modeles = Modele::all();
     $types = Type::all();
     return view('backoffice.vehicules', compact("vehicules", "membres", "modeles", "types"));
 }
Пример #2
0
 /**
  * Show the form for editing the specified resource.
  *
  * @param  int  $id
  * @return \Illuminate\Http\Response
  */
 public function edit($id)
 {
     $types = Type::all();
     $marques = Marque::all();
     $modeles = Modele::all();
     $couleurs = Couleur::all();
     $vehicule = Vehicule::find($id);
     $idMarque = DB::table('modele')->join('marque', 'marque.marque_id', '=', 'modele.marque_id')->select('marque.marque_id')->where('modele.modele_id', $vehicule->modele_id)->get()[0]->marque_id;
     $idType = DB::table('marque')->join('type', 'type.type_id', '=', 'marque.type_id')->select('type.type_id')->where('marque.marque_id', $idMarque)->get()[0]->type_id;
     return view('dashboard.profile.vehicule.edit_car', ['types' => $types, 'marques' => $marques, 'marqueCourante' => $idMarque, 'modeles' => $modeles, 'typeCourant' => $idType, 'couleurs' => $couleurs, 'vehicule' => $vehicule]);
 }
Пример #3
0
 /**
  * Display a listing of the resource.
  *
  * @return \Illuminate\Http\Response
  */
 public function index()
 {
     //
     //dd($this->User()->id);
     $cars = array();
     $models = array();
     $car = Car::all();
     $title = "Ajout Disponibilité";
     foreach ($car as $c) {
         $cars[$c->id] = $c->model;
     }
     $model = Modele::all();
     foreach ($model as $m) {
         $models[$m->id] = $m->name;
     }
     $date = \Carbon\Carbon::today();
     $date = $date->format('Y-m-d');
     return view('TestDrives/disponibility-test-drive', ['title' => $title, 'cars' => $cars, 'date' => $date, 'models' => $models]);
 }
 public function add(Request $request)
 {
     $modele = Modele::create(['nomMod' => $request->input('nomMod'), 'idMarq' => $request->input('idMarq')]);
     $modele->save();
     return redirect()->route('backModel');
 }
Пример #5
0
 public function getFinition($id)
 {
     $list_car = array();
     $cars = array();
     $model = Modele::findOrFail($id);
     $list_car = $model->cars()->get();
     foreach ($list_car as $car) {
         $cars[$car->id] = $car->finition;
     }
     return json_encode($cars);
 }
 /**
  * Run the database seeds.
  *
  * @return void
  */
 public function run()
 {
     Modele::create(['idMod' => 1, 'nomMod' => 'clio', 'idMarq' => 1]);
     Modele::create(['idMod' => 2, 'nomMod' => 'Fazer', 'idMarq' => 2]);
 }
Пример #7
0
 public function frontIndex()
 {
     $title = 'Audi front';
     // $cars=array();
     $modele = Modele::all();
     /* dd($car);
              foreach ($car as $c) {
                  $cars[$c->id] = $c->model;
     
              }
      */
     return view('Front.front', ['title' => $title, 'modele' => $modele]);
 }